Waterfront Transformation in Progress
Lakeview is an exciting neighbourhood undergoing a major transformation from its industrial roots to a vibrant waterfront community. The Lakeview Village development is creating thousands of new homes, parks, and amenities along the Lake Ontario shoreline. Early buyers are positioning themselves in what will become one of the GTA's most sought-after waterfront communities.

Things to Confirm Before Signing
· Are utilities included, or separate?
· How many parking spots are included?
· Is the landlord open to a 1-year or 2-year lease?
· Are pets and small renovations (paint, hooks) allowed?
· When was the last rent increase, if there is a prior tenant?
Utility estimates are approximate and vary by season, habits, and what the landlord includes. Always confirm inclusions with the listing agent.

Condo Considerations
For condos, I always review the status certificate thoroughly. Key things I look for: reserve fund health (should be well-funded), any upcoming special assessments, rules that might affect your lifestyle (pets, rentals, renovations), and the corporation's financial statements. We'll want to verify the monthly fees and what they include.
